diff --git a/localization/strings/zh-CN/Resources.resw b/localization/strings/zh-CN/Resources.resw
index 6188c44..e336d02 100644
--- a/localization/strings/zh-CN/Resources.resw
+++ b/localization/strings/zh-CN/Resources.resw
@@ -132,7 +132,7 @@
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
- 该磁盘“{}”已连接。
+ 磁盘“{}”已连接。
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
@@ -683,7 +683,7 @@ Windows: {}
正在导入,这可能需要几分钟时间。
- 通过 {} 或 /etc/wsl.conf 禁用 GUI 应用程序支持。
+ 已通过 {} 或 /etc/wsl.conf 禁用 GUI 应用程序支持。
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
@@ -822,11 +822,11 @@ Windows: {}
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
- 分发名称无效:“{}”。
+ 无效分发名称:“{}”。
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
- 使用旧分发注册。请考虑改用基于 tar 的分发。
+ 正在使用旧分发注册。请考虑改用基于 tar 的分发。
旧分发注册不支持 --version 参数。
@@ -864,7 +864,7 @@ Windows: {}
此计算机上不支持嵌套虚拟化。
- 无法创建地址为“{}”的网络终结点,已分配新地址:“{}”
+ 无法创建地址为“{}”的网络端点,已分配新地址:“{}”
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
@@ -905,10 +905,10 @@ Windows: {}
检测到 IPv6 代理配置,但未镜像到 WSL。NAT 模式下的 WSL 不支持 IPv6。
- 检测到 localhost IPv6 代理配置,但未镜像到 WSL 中。WSL 不支持 localhost IPv6 代理。
+ 检测到 localhost IPv6 代理配置,但未镜像到 WSL。WSL 不支持 localhost IPv6 代理。
- 尝试解析代理设置时发生意外错误,代理设置未镜像到 WSL 中。
+ 尝试解析代理设置时发生意外错误,代理设置未镜像到 WSL。
访问注册表时出错。路径:“{}”。错误: {}
@@ -947,14 +947,14 @@ Windows: {}
{FixedPlaceholder="{}"}{Locked=".wslconfig"}Command line arguments, file names and string inserts should not be translated
- 计算机策略禁用调试 shell。
+ 计算机策略已禁用调试 shell。
wsl.exe --mount 被计算机策略禁用。
{Locked="--mount "}Command line arguments, file names and string inserts should not be translated
- WSL1 被计算机策略禁用。
+ 计算机策略已禁用 WSL1。
请运行“wsl.exe --set-version {} 2”以升级到 WSL2。
@@ -1070,7 +1070,7 @@ Windows: {}
{Locked="--vhd "}Command line arguments, file names and string inserts should not be translated
- 未能从以下Microsoft Store安装 {}: {}
+ 未能从 Microsoft Store 安装 {}:{}
正在尝试 Web 下载...
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
@@ -1082,7 +1082,7 @@ Windows: {}
WSL 安装似乎已损坏 (错误代码: {})。
-按任意键修复 WSL,或 CTRL-C 取消。
+按任意键修复 WSL,或按 CTRL-C 取消。
此提示将在 60 秒后超时。
{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
@@ -1114,7 +1114,7 @@ Windows: {}
提供的自定义内核模块未指定自定义内核。有关详细信息,请参阅 https://aka.ms/wslcustomkernel。
- 由于当前与全球安全访问客户端的兼容性问题,DNS 隧道被禁用。
+ 由于当前与全局安全访问客户端的兼容性问题,DNS 隧道被禁用。
由于潜在的数据损坏,目前已禁用稀疏 VHD 支持。
@@ -1127,7 +1127,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
- 使用装载 -a 处理 /etc/fstab 失败。
+ 使用 mount -a 处理 /etc/fstab 失败。
装载分发磁盘时出错,该磁盘作为回退以只读方式装载。
@@ -1138,7 +1138,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e{FixedPlaceholder="{}"}Command line arguments, file names and string inserts should not be translated
- 出现错误。请稍后再试一次。
+ 出现错误。请稍后再试。
关于
@@ -1160,28 +1160,28 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e自动内存回收
- 检测到空闲 CPU 使用情况后自动释放缓存内存。为缓存的即时释放设置为慢速释放和 dropcache。
+ 检测到空闲 CPU 使用情况后自动释放缓存内存。设为 gradual 缓慢释放;设为 dropcache 迅速释放。
自动内存回收。
- 检测到空闲 CPU 使用情况后自动释放缓存内存。为缓存的即时释放设置为慢速释放和 dropcache。
+ 检测到空闲 CPU 使用情况后自动释放缓存内存。设为 gradual 缓慢释放;设为 dropcache 迅速释放。
已启用自动代理
- 使 WSL 能够使用 Windows 的 HTTP 代理信息。
+ 允许 WSL 使用 Windows 的 HTTP 代理信息。
已启用自动代理。
- 使 WSL 能够使用 Windows 的 HTTP 代理信息。
+ 允许 WSL 使用 Windows 的 HTTP 代理信息。
- 尽力进行 DNS 分析
+ 尽力进行 DNS 解析
仅当 wsl2.dnsTunneling 设置为 true 时适用。设置为 true 时,Windows 将从 DNS 请求中提取问题并尝试解决该问题,忽略未知记录。
@@ -1191,7 +1191,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e尽力进行 DNS 分析。
- 仅当 wsl2.dnsTunneling 设置为 true 时才适用。设置为 true 时,Windows 将从 DNS 请求中提取问题并尝试解决该问题,忽略未知记录。
+ 仅当 wsl2.dnsTunneling 设置为 true 时适用。设置为 true 时,Windows 将从 DNS 请求中提取问题并尝试解决该问题,忽略未知记录。
自定义内核
@@ -1230,7 +1230,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e浏览发行版
- 指定 VHD 的路径,该路径将作为自定义系统发行版加载,主要用于为 WSL 中的 GUI 应用提供电源。[在此处详细了解系统发行]。
+ 指定一个 VHD 路径,该 VHD 将作为自定义系统发行版加载,主要用于在 WSL 中运行 GUI 应用。[在此处详细了解系统发行]。
{Locked="["}{Locked="]"}The text in between the delimiters [ ] is made into a hyperlink in code, and the delimiters are removed
@@ -1241,7 +1241,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e自定义系统发行版
- 指定 VHD 的路径,该路径将作为自定义系统发行版加载,主要用于为 WSL 中的 GUI 应用提供电源。
+ 指定一个 VHD 路径,该 VHD 将作为自定义系统发行版加载,主要用于在 WSL 中运行 GUI 应用。
启用调试控制台
@@ -1259,7 +1259,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e默认 VHD 大小
- 对于新创建的分发,可扩展 WSL 虚拟硬盘 (VHD) 的默认最大大小。
+ 为可扩展的 WSL 虚拟硬盘指定的默认最大大小 (VHD),仅用于新创建的分发。
重设大小
@@ -1268,7 +1268,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e默认 VHD 大小
- 为可扩展的 WSL 虚拟硬盘指定的默认最大大小 (VHD) 仅用于新创建的分发。
+ 为可扩展的 WSL 虚拟硬盘指定的默认最大大小 (VHD),仅用于新创建的分发。
开发人员
@@ -1284,20 +1284,20 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e更改 DrvFS 模式
- 更改 WSL 中的跨 OS 文件访问实施。
+ 更改 WSL 中的跨系统文件访问实现。
已启用 DNS 代理
- 仅当 wsl2.networkingMode 设置为 NAT 时适用。布尔值通知 WSL 将 Linux 中的 DNS 服务器配置为主机上的 NAT。设置为 false 将镜像从 Windows 到 Linux 的 DNS 服务器。
+ 仅当 wsl2.networkingMode 设置为 NAT 时适用。用于通知 WSL 将 Linux 中的 DNS 服务器配置为主机上的 NAT 的布尔值。设置为 false 将把 Windows 中 DNS 服务器镜像到 Linux。
{Locked="wsl2.networkingMode"}.wslconfig property key names should not be translated
已启用 DNS 代理。
- 仅当 wsl2.networkingMode 设置为 NAT 时适用。布尔值通知 WSL 将 Linux 中的 DNS 服务器配置为主机上的 NAT。设置为 false 将镜像从 Windows 到 Linux 的 DNS 服务器。
+ 仅当 wsl2.networkingMode 设置为 NAT 时适用。用于通知 WSL 将 Linux 中的 DNS 服务器配置为主机上的 NAT 的布尔值。设置为 false 将把 Windows 中 DNS 服务器镜像到 Linux。
已启用 DNS 隧道
@@ -1358,20 +1358,20 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e主机地址环回
- 仅当 wsl2.networkingMode 设置为镜像时适用。设置为 True 时,将允许容器通过分配给主机的 IP 地址连接到主机或主机连接到容器。请注意,始终可以使用 127.0.0.1 环回地址 - 此选项还允许使用所有额外分配的本地 IP 地址。
+ 仅当 wsl2.networkingMode 设置为镜像(mirrored)时适用。设置为 True 时,将允许容器与主机通过分配给主机的 IP 地址互相连接。请注意,始终可以使用 127.0.0.1 环回地址 - 此选项还允许使用所有额外分配的本地 IP 地址。
{Locked="wsl2.networkingMode"}.wslconfig property key names should not be translated
主机地址环回。
- 仅当 wsl2.networkingMode 设置为镜像时适用。设置为 True 时,将允许容器通过分配给主机的 IP 地址连接到主机或主机连接到容器。请注意,始终可以使用 127.0.0.1 环回地址 - 此选项还允许使用所有额外分配的本地 IP 地址。
+ 仅当 wsl2.networkingMode 设置为镜像(mirrored)时适用。设置为 True 时,将允许容器与主机通过分配给主机的 IP 地址互相连接。请注意,始终可以使用 127.0.0.1 环回地址 - 此选项还允许使用所有额外分配的本地 IP 地址。
忽略的端口
- 仅当 wsl2.networkingMode 设置为镜像时适用。指定 Linux 应用程序可以绑定到的端口,不会在 Windows 中自动转发或考虑这些端口。应以逗号分隔的列表格式化,例如: 3000,9000,9090。
+ 仅当 wsl2.networkingMode 设置为镜像(mirrored)时适用。指定 Linux 应用程序可以绑定的端口,这些端口不会 Windows 自动转发或考虑。应采用逗号分隔的列表格式,例如:3000,9000,9090。
{Locked="wsl2.networkingMode"}.wslconfig property key names should not be translated
@@ -1381,13 +1381,13 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e忽略的端口
- 仅当 wsl2.networkingMode 设置为镜像时适用。指定 Linux 应用程序可以绑定到的端口,不会在 Windows 中自动转发或考虑这些端口。应以逗号分隔的列表格式化,例如 3000、9000、9090。
+ 仅当 wsl2.networkingMode 设置为镜像(mirrored)时适用。指定 Linux 应用程序可以绑定的端口,这些端口不会在 Windows 中自动转发或考虑。应采用逗号分隔的列表格式,例如 3000,9000,9090。
初始自动代理超时
- 仅当 wsl2.autoProxy 设置为 true 时适用。配置在启动 WSL 容器时 WSL 等待检索 HTTP 代理信息) (毫秒。如果在此时间后解析代理设置,则必须重新启动 WSL 实例才能使用检索到的代理设置。
+ 仅当 wsl2.autoProxy 设置为 true 时适用。配置启动 WSL 容器时 WSL 等待检索 HTTP 代理信息的时间(以毫秒计)。如果在此时间后解析到代理设置,则必须重新启动 WSL 实例才能使用检索到的代理设置。
{Locked="wsl2.autoProxy"}.wslconfig property key names should not be translated
@@ -1397,25 +1397,25 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e初始自动代理超时
- 仅当 wsl2.autoProxy 设置为 true 时才适用。配置启动 WSL 容器时 WSL 等待检索 HTTP 代理信息的时间,以毫秒为单位。如果在此时间后解析代理设置,则必须重新启动 WSL 实例才能使用检索到的代理设置。
+ 仅当 wsl2.autoProxy 设置为 true 时才适用。配置启动 WSL 容器时 WSL 等待检索 HTTP 代理信息的时间,以毫秒为单位。如果在此时间后解析到代理设置,则必须重新启动 WSL 实例才能使用检索到的代理设置。
内核命令行
- 其他内核命令行参数。
+ 额外的内核命令行参数。
启用 localhost 转发
- 布尔值,指定是否应通过 localhost:port 从主机连接到 WSL 2 VM 中通配符或 localhost 的端口。
+ 布尔值,用于指定 WSL 2 VM 中绑定通配符或本地主机的端口是否应允许主机通过`localhost:端口号`进行连接。
启用 localhost 转发。
- 一个布尔值,指定绑定到 WSL 2 VM 中的通配符或 localhost 的端口是否应可通过 localhost、colon、port 从主机连接。
+ 布尔值,用于指定 WSL 2 VM 中绑定通配符或本地主机的端口是否应允许主机通过`localhost:端口号`进行连接。
{0} MB
@@ -1445,13 +1445,13 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e启用嵌套虚拟化
- 用于打开或关闭嵌套虚拟化的布尔值,使其他嵌套 VM 能够在 WSL 2 内运行。
+ 用于打开或关闭嵌套虚拟化的布尔值,使其他嵌套虚拟机能够在 WSL 2 内运行。
启用嵌套虚拟化。
- 用于打开或关闭嵌套虚拟化的布尔值,使其他嵌套 VM 能够在 WSL 2 内运行。
+ 用于打开或关闭嵌套虚拟化的布尔值,使其他嵌套虚拟机能够在 WSL 2 内运行。
网络模式
@@ -1472,7 +1472,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e你可以跨操作系统处理所有文件!
- 跨 OS 文件访问
+ 跨系统文件访问
从 Linux 访问 Windows 文件
@@ -1515,7 +1515,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afeWSL 还包括一种称为镜像模式的新网络模式,该模式添加了 IPv6 支持等高级功能,并且能够访问局域网中的网络应用程序。
- 了解有关跨 OS 文件访问的详细信息
+ 了解有关跨系统文件访问的详细信息
https://aka.ms/wslfilesystems
@@ -1552,7 +1552,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e{Locked="-l -o"}Command line arguments and file names should not be translated
- 安装命名的 WSL 发行版命令
+ 安装指定名称的 WSL 发行版命令
'wsl.exe --install <DistroName>'
@@ -1568,11 +1568,11 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e
Docker Desktop 非常适合与 WSL 配合使用,可帮助你使用 Linux 容器进行开发。
-将 Docker Desktop 与 WSL 配合使用的一些优点是:
+一些将 Docker Desktop 与 WSL 配合使用的优点:
• 可以使用相同的 Docker 守护程序和映像在 WSL 或 Windows 中运行 Docker 命令。
• 可以使用 WSL 中的 Windows 驱动器自动装载功能在 Windows 和 Linux 之间无缝共享文件和文件夹。
-• 由于 WSL 的互操作性,你可以使用首选的 Windows 工具和编辑器处理 Linux 代码和文件,反之亦然。
+• 由于 WSL 的互操作性,你可以使用偏好的 Windows 工具和编辑器处理 Linux 代码和文件,反之亦然。
Docker Desktop 集成
@@ -1754,7 +1754,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e关于
- 开发商
+ 开发人员
发行版管理
@@ -1802,7 +1802,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e新增功能
- 跨文件系统工作
+ 跨系统文件访问
问题
@@ -1857,7 +1857,7 @@ wsl.exe --manage <DistributionName> --set-sparse true --allow-unsafe启用 VirtIO
- 使用 virtiofs 而不是计划 9 来访问主机文件,加快速度。
+ 使用 virtiofs 而不是 plan 9 来访问主机文件,加快速度。
启用 Virtio 9p